According to 314.16(C), what is required for conduit bodies enclosing 6 AWG conductors or smaller?

Enhance your skills with the Electrical Code Calculations, Level I (1-4) Test. Use flashcards and multiple choice questions, complete with hints and explanations, to get exam-ready!

The requirement outlined in 314.16(C) specifies that conduit bodies containing conductors must have a minimum cross-sectional area that is at least twice the largest conduit area. This regulation is in place to ensure that there is adequate space within the conduit body for the conductors, facilitating proper installation and reducing the risk of overheating, conductor damage, or degradation due to overcrowding.

When a conduit body contains multiple conductors, particularly larger ones like 6 AWG or smaller, having an appropriate cross-sectional area ensures that there is sufficient room not only for the conductors themselves but also for any necessary bends or changes in direction. This also allows for effective heat dissipation, which is crucial for maintaining safe operational temperatures within the electrical system.
